Overflowing Toilets is an emergency plumbing service that quickly resolves blockages and mechanical failures causing toilets to flood. Technicians assess causes such as clogs, faulty fill valves, or sewer line issues, and apply sanitation and repair methods to reestablish function. This service is essential for maintaining hygiene and preventing water damage
